On Wed, 17 May 2006 20:51:07 +0000, John Salerno wrote: > Ok, I've tinkered with this thing for a while, and I keep fixing little > problems, but I always get a 500 Internal Server error when I go to this > site: > > I don't necessarily even want help just yet, I'd like to figure it out > myself, but can someone at least tell me why I'm not getting helpful > feedback from the cgitb module? Am I using it wrong? The webpage just > displays the internal server error. > > Thanks.
Having to debug web scripts on hosts where you don't have shell access can be a major pain. If you are referring to the wrong path in the "bang-path" line, you'd get that error non-message. Likewise if the file permissions were wrong. -- http://mail.python.org/mailman/listinfo/python-list
